## Environment Variables — Incremental Rebuilds (Staticore)

Plugin authors can trigger partial rebuilds via the rebuild hook. `REBUILD_SCOPE` limits regeneration to changed routes, and `REBUILD_CONCURRENCY` defaults to 4. Hooks fire after content ingestion but before asset hashing. To call the rebuild API from a plugin, your env file must include the webhook credential on the following line:

env line for fafof-fahag: LEDGER_TOKEN5=f8790

The Marrowgate internal gateway enforces per-plugin token buckets. Each plugin key gets an independent bucket; exceeding it yields a 429 with a reset hint. Burst capacity exists but drains fast — design for steady-state throughput, not spikes. Limits are evaluated at the edge before routing, so retries against a drained bucket waste your quota. Quota increases require a capacity review with the Marrowgate platform crew. Plugins sharing a key share a bucket; split keys if you need isolation. The enforced constants are shown below.

tuning constants:
RATE_LIMITS = {
    "wenwyn": 1,
    "zorix": 10,
    "oliix": 2,
    "holael": 10,
}

## Markdown Pipeline — Contacts

The Inkrelay rendering pipeline converts authored markdown into the published docs on Foliage. Ownership: the Typesetter squad owns parsing and sanitization; the Foliage team owns theming and deploys. Rendering bugs (broken tables, mangled code blocks) go to Typesetter. Publish delays or cache staleness go to Foliage. Do not raise pipeline issues in the general eng channel — they get lost. For anything ambiguous, or to request a new renderer extension, contact the pipeline leads at the address below.

pager mailbox: silael.sorwyn.tamius@zemvarsys.corp